As I go through Oxnard and look into hole-in-the-wall eateries I was recommended this place to try by the locals. Jungle Juice is located in a small strip mall, I don't even know if it's even considered a strip mall. Anywhoo, it's located next to a couple of other eateries and some shops, easy to miss; especially during the night since their sign isn't working.
Ordered horchata and carne asada torta with everything. The horchata was blended, so a horchata smoothie. It was so smooth and had a thick consistency, not as thick as a milkshake, however not your usual watery horchata. Because it's blended the flavor held so much better and you know how the cinnamon and some of the rice powder settles to the bottom? Well in this horchata everything was dispersed evenely and it helped because it's blended. It is $6.25 for a large and it sounds pricey, it's worth it.
The torta hit the spot as well, and for $6.75 it was worth it as well. There wasn't anything extravagant with the service, it was meh. I have to say though the horchata is worth visiting Jungle Juice. That is all. Happy eatings!! ^__^
